Identification of a novel Rac1‐interacting protein involved in membrane ruffling.
Explore this paper's citation graph
Summary
Truncated versions of POR1 inhibit the induction of membrane ruffling by an activated mutant of Rac1, V12Rac1, in quiescent rat embryonic fibroblast REF52 cells and synergizes with an activated mutants of Ras, V 12Ras, inThe results suggest a potential role for P OR1 in Rac1‐mediated signaling pathways.
